Ms. Karen - Administrative Director

Karen, our Administrative Director, has more than twenty years of experience as a previous business owner and Human Resource Executive. Prior to founding Gold Hill Preschool, Karen obtained her Certification in Early Childhood Education with the goal of developing a nurturing and enriching environment where young children can grow, learn, and thrive.

Karen is known for her hands-on approach, strong communication skills, and commitment to educational excellence. She works closely with families and staff to ensure the development of the whole child—socially, emotionally, and academically while fostering a positive work culture. Karen also teaches basic writing skills encouraging children to develop a strong foundation for future handwriting.

Karen received a B.S. in Business Administration from Ohio State University and a Masters in Human Resource Law from Troy University. She is SHRM-SCP certified, a licensed Paralegal and holds a North Carolina Early Childhood Administrative Certification.

Ms. Rhonda - Admin. Assistant

Rhonda is the Administrative Assistant with 21 years of experience in early childhood education. She attended York Technical College, where she studied Early Childhood Education, and also holds an NC Early Childhood Equivalency Certificate. Throughout her career, Rhonda has served in nearly every area of a child care setting, from teaching children of all ages to leading as a school-age and after-school coordinator.

Her passion for working with young children is evident in her commitment to creating a nurturing and calm environment where young minds can flourish. Rhonda also values building strong relationships with families, fostering meaningful connections that support children’s growth and development. Ms. Angie - Preschool Lead

Angie has been dedicated to the field of Early Childhood Education since 2005, officially stepping into the role of a full-time teacher in 2007. With a background in communications, she initially entered the field unexpectedly, taking a summer position at her sons’ daycare while seeking work. This experience sparked a deep interest in child development as she supported both infants and three-year-olds, inspiring her to pursue a meaningful career in guiding young minds through critical developmental milestones.

In 2014, Angie earned her Master’s degree in Education, further solidifying her commitment to fostering growth in early learners. Her passion lies particularly with three-year-olds, whom she considers to be at a remarkable stage of cognitive and emotional development, as they begin to make connections between their tasks, growth, and understanding of the world. She feels privileged to play a role in their journey and strives to provide a nurturing, patient, and positive environment for discovery.
